Secondly, our talks will center around the DVDs entitled, Back To Eden. From the award winning director of The Color of Fear, comes Lee Mun Wah’s film about nine women and men who begin an honest and emotionally charged conversation about how racism and sexism has affected their lives and families. Each of their stories is filled with history, courage, and wisdom. Their  voices and struggle remind us how much further we still need to go.
